%S 49,8464,20449,60025,2304324,3624882849
%N Squares which are a sum of consecutive squares starting with 7^2.
%C That is, terms are squares of the form sum_{i=7..m} i^2 for some m. This sequence is complete. See A180442 and A184763.
%e a(2) = 8464 = 92^2 = 7^2+8^2+9^2+...+28^2+29^2.
%t Select[Accumulate[Range[7,3000]^2],IntegerQ[Sqrt[#]]&] (* _Harvey P. Dale_, Jul 16 2014 *)
%o (PARI) for(n=8,9999999,t=n*(n+1)*(2*n+1)/6-91;if(issquare(t),print1(t,",")))
